Customer Success Associate

2 months ago


San Antonio, United States Insight Global Full time
Job DescriptionJob Description

Insight Global is looking for a Customer Success Associate to join the customer operations team. This person will act as the liaison between the lab operations team and the clients. They will troubleshoot and resolve client issues over the phone and via email. They will be responsible for gathering data and providing information to the clients from lab. They will input donor information into the internal lab systems and maintain all confidentiality processes. This person will also coordinate times for clients to pick up and drop off specimens at the lab. They will oversee entry of patient donor data into national database and perform client onboarding for all new clients in the organization.

Required Skills & Experience

* experience in data entry, patient onboarding, tracking/logging metrics or data in computer programs * experience in customer service and correspondence over email * Proficient in all Microsoft applications, Outlook, and other computer tracking programs * Needs to be a efficient multi-tasker & manage several task and projects at any given time

Nice to Have Skills & Experience

* Bachelors Degree * Background in clinical, healthcare, or medical space



  • San Antonio, Texas, United States Swivel Full time

    Customer Success AssociateAt Swivel, we're seeking a talented Customer Success Associate to join our team. As a key member of our customer-facing sales teams, you'll leverage your extensive knowledge of our software to support sales and new business growth.Key Responsibilities:Build customer success plans, establishing critical goals to help customers reach...


  • San Antonio, Texas, United States Insight Global Full time

    Job Title: Customer Success AssociateJob Summary: We are seeking a highly skilled Customer Success Associate to join our team at Insight Global. This role will involve acting as a liaison between our lab operations team and clients, troubleshooting and resolving client issues over the phone and via email.Key Responsibilities:Act as a liaison between the lab...


  • San Antonio, Texas, United States Insight Global Full time

    Customer Success AssociateWe are seeking a highly skilled and detail-oriented Customer Success Associate to join our team in San Antonio, TX. As a key member of our customer operations team, you will serve as the primary point of contact for clients, providing exceptional support and ensuring seamless interactions.Key Responsibilities:Act as liaison between...


  • San Antonio, Texas, United States Swivel Full time

    About the Role:Swivel is seeking a highly skilled Customer Success Associate to join our team. As a key member of our customer-facing sales teams, you will leverage your extensive knowledge of Swivel software to support sales and new business growth. Your primary responsibility will be to work with customers to build customer success plans, establishing...


  • San Antonio, Texas, United States SWBC Full time

    About the Role:SWBC is seeking a talented Customer Success Associate to join our team. As a key member of our customer-facing sales teams, you will leverage your extensive knowledge of SWIVEL software to support sales and new business growth.Key Responsibilities:Build customer success plans, establishing critical goals, to help customers reach their...


  • San Antonio, Texas, United States Swivel Full time

    About the Role:Swivel is seeking a talented Customer Success Associate to join our team. As a key member of our customer-facing sales teams, you will leverage your extensive knowledge of Swivel software to support sales and new business growth.Key Responsibilities:Develop and strengthen relationships with customers within your designated territory.Work with...


  • San Antonio, United States Southwest Business Corp Full time

    A Customer Success Associate (CSA) is an essential part of Software as a Service (Saas) companies in todays climate. As a CSA, you will be responsible for developing and strengthening relationships with customers within your designated territory. Yo Associate, Account Manager, Customer Engagement, Retail, Customer, Business, Skills


  • San Antonio, United States SWBC - Southwest Business Corporation Full time

    A Customer Success Associate (CSA) is an essential part of Software as a Service (Saas) companies in todays climate. As a CSA, you will be responsible for developing and strengthening relationships with customers within your designated territory. Yo Associate, Account Manager, Customer Engagement, Retail, Banking, Customer, Business, Skills


  • San Antonio, United States SWBC Full time

    SWIVEL is seeking a talented individual to report to the Customer Success Manager, a CSA will play a vital role in ensuring customers achieve their desired outcomes while using SWIVEL's software. CSAs should be customer-focused and aim for mutually beneficial outcomes within the partnership. Working collaboratively with Product Teams, the CSA will be...


  • San Antonio, Texas, United States SWBC - Southwest Business Corporation Full time

    Customer Success Associate RoleA Customer Success Associate is a vital component of Software as a Service (SaaS) companies in today's market. As a CSA, you will be responsible for fostering and strengthening relationships with customers within your designated territory.Key Responsibilities:Develop and maintain strong relationships with customers to ensure...


  • San Antonio, Texas, United States SWBC - Southwest Business Corporation Full time

    Customer Success at SWBCAs a Customer Success Associate at SWBC - Southwest Business Corporation, you will play a vital role in developing and strengthening relationships with customers within your designated territory. Your primary responsibility will be to ensure customer satisfaction and retention, driving long-term growth and revenue for the company.Key...


  • San Antonio, Texas, United States Insight Global Full time

    Customer Success Associate - Liaison RoleWe are seeking a highly skilled Customer Success Associate to join our team in San Antonio, TX. As a liaison between our lab operations team and clients, you will be responsible for troubleshooting and resolving client issues over the phone and via email. Your primary goal will be to ensure seamless communication and...


  • San Antonio, Texas, United States SWBC - Southwest Business Corporation Full time

    Customer Success at SWBCAs a Customer Success Associate at SWBC - Southwest Business Corporation, you will play a vital role in developing and strengthening relationships with customers within your designated territory. This position requires a unique blend of business acumen, communication skills, and technical knowledge to ensure customer satisfaction and...


  • San Jose, California, United States PMT Management Full time

    Job DescriptionWe are seeking a highly motivated and enthusiastic individual to join our team as a Customer Success Associate. As a key member of our PMT Management team, you will play a vital role in helping our clients achieve their business goals.As a Customer Success Associate, you will be responsible for:Developing and maintaining strong relationships...


  • San Antonio, Texas, United States Insight Global Full time

    Customer Success AssociateAn exciting opportunity has arisen for a Customer Success Associate to join our team at Insight Global in San Antonio, TX. As a key member of our customer operations team, you will play a vital role in ensuring seamless interactions between our lab operations team and clients.Key Responsibilities:Act as the primary point of contact...


  • San Diego, California, United States PracticeTek Full time

    About the RoleWe are seeking a highly skilled Customer Success Associate to join our team at PracticeTek. As a key member of our Customer Success Department, you will play a vital role in ensuring our customers receive exceptional support and service.Key ResponsibilitiesProvide timely and effective support to customers via phone, email, and other...


  • San Antonio, Texas, United States Insight Global Full time

    Job OverviewWe are seeking a highly organized and detail-oriented Customer Success Associate to join our customer operations team at Insight Global. As a key liaison between our lab operations team and clients, you will play a critical role in ensuring seamless communication and issue resolution.Key Responsibilities:Act as the primary point of contact for...


  • San Antonio, United States TINT Full time

    About TINTHi, we're TINT! Our mission is to address the problems of falling consumer trust in brands and diminishing returns on marketing spend.We built the platform to make it easy to identify, engage, and mobilize consumers. And we developed our methodology, a proven process to create a thriving brand community with immediate impact and lasting business...


  • San Antonio, Texas, United States Centage Full time

    Centage is a trusted name in FP&A software, offering products like Budget Maestro, Planning Maestro, and Analytics Maestro.The Customer Success Manager will be responsible for ensuring customer satisfaction, customer retention, analyzing customer data, building and maintaining relationships, and providing exceptional customer service on a daily basis.Key...


  • San Antonio, Texas, United States Pro-Vigil, Inc Full time

    Job SummaryPro-Vigil, Inc is seeking a highly skilled Customer Success Manager to join our team. As a key member of our Outside Sales Team, you will be responsible for ensuring excellent customer service and driving sales growth.Key ResponsibilitiesProvide exceptional customer service and support to our clientsWork closely with Outside Sales/Territory...